2. Procedure:
Run wd_tcpdump_trace -i iface on the command prompt where iface is one of the
interfaces whose traffic you want to trace. In the above diagram its port 0 or port 1.
[root@host]# wd_tcpdump_trace -i <iface>
Try ping or ssh between machines A and B. The traffic should successfully make it from end to
end and wd_tcpdump_trace on the DUT should show the tapped traffic.
